Benchmark and Unit Test Results of the Message-Passing GEOS General Circulation Model

This document contains the benchmarking and unit test results for the message-passing God-dard Earth Observing System General Circulation Model (MP GEOS GCM). The MP GEOS GCM is an atmospheric model which operates on uniform and stretched latitude-longitude grids and is closely related to the shared memory parallel GEOS GCM which is currently in production at the Data Assimilation OOce. The unit tests give an indication that individual components on the MP GEOS GCM are performing as expected and that the results for a given processor connguration are reproducible. The benchmarks reeect the overall performance of the MP GEOS GCM and give an idea of how the application might perform in a production setting.
